Job Description
Operate, install, calibrate, and maintain integrated computer/communications systems, consoles, simulators, and other data acquisition, test, and measurement instruments and equipment, which are used to launch, track, position, and evaluate air and space vehicles. May record and interpret test data.
Job Details
- The SOC (Standard Occupational Classification) code is 17-3021.00
- The Mean Annual Wage in the U.S. is $ 71,070.00
- The Mean Hourly Wage is $ 34.00
- Currently, there are 11,970 people on this job
☝️ Information based on the reference occupation “Aerospace Engineering and Operations Technicians”.

Tasks for “Engineering Technician”
- Inspect, diagnose, maintain, and operate test setups and equipment to detect malfunctions.
- Identify required data, data acquisition plans and test parameters, setting up equipment to conform to these specifications.
- Confer with engineering personnel regarding details and implications of test procedures and results.
- Test aircraft systems under simulated operational conditions, performing systems readiness tests and pre- and post-operational checkouts, to establish design or fabrication parameters.
- Fabricate and install parts and systems to be tested in test equipment, using hand tools, power tools, and test instruments.
- Record and interpret test data on parts, assemblies, and mechanisms.
- Operate and calibrate computer systems and devices to comply with test requirements and to perform data acquisition and analysis.
- Exchange cooling system components in various vehicles.
- Adjust, repair or replace faulty components of test setups and equipment.
- Finish vehicle instrumentation and deinstrumentation.
- Construct and maintain test facilities for aircraft parts and systems, according to specifications.
